"Support For The Gospel"
By Hilton Sutton, Th.D.
Taken from “End Time Update” Summer / Fall 2002

Across the board, income for ministries has dropped. The decline began during the year 2000 and dipped more sharply after the September 11th terrorist strike. This far in this New Year, ministries are not reporting increase in their financial statements. Without proper financial support ministries are hindered in the process of carrying out the vision God has given them.

When the going forth of ministry is hindered, Satan is succeeding. The only way this can possibly happen is for God's people to fail in their giving. God has chosen to supply for His work through tithes and offerings from His children. The tithe, a tenth, belongs to our Father and can never be considered a personal possession. An offering comes from one's personal funds, and is in excess of the tithe.

The ministry in which I serve is the ministry of Jesus. His ministry was broad and multifaceted. To fulfill His ministry today requires Apostles, Prophets, Evangelists, Pastors, and Teachers. All must be financially underwritten by those who have chosen to follow Jesus.

God states in Malachi 3:6 and James 1:17 that He does not change. So, it remains His perfect plan that the believing community financially support God's ministry.

Here are some startling facts: Research reveals that approximately only one-seventh of the Christian community tithes. Six-sevenths of God's people fall under the curse through their disobedience. Read carefully the 28th Chapter of Deuteronomy.

Did God mean what lie said when He stated He would "OPEN THE WINDOWS OF HEAVEN and POUR OUT BLESSINGS and REBUKE THE DEVOURER" for those who tithe and give offerings? The answer is YES, and He has kept His Word for those who have been obedient (Malachi 3:10-11).

Another interesting but sad state of affairs is that only 15% of the Christian community read and study the Bible. With so little intake of the Word it is no wonder Christians lack motivation. The Bible is the greatest motivational book in the world. To neglect the study of the scriptures is to neglect one's spiritual life.

Are you ready for one more startling fact? Prayer, once a vital daily part of a Christian's life has become almost a thing of the past. We are much too busy with mundane matters. The cares of life, deceitfulness of riches and lust for things, has choked the Word and made it unfruitful. In the biblical account of Jesus with Mary and Martha, Martha was the one careful and troubled about many things. She had very little quality time with the Master.

I have addressed three serious matters within our camp: giving, studying the Word, and prayer. All take commitment and discipline.
I trust these words have spoken to your heart. Believe that you can increase your giving, study more diligently and truly develop a prayer life. I can assure you, if you do these things, you will have QUALITY TIME with the Father, Son, and Holy Spirit. A devout relationship with our Father, our Savior, and the Holy Spirit is far more valuable than houses and lands, or silver and gold.

I am praying for your success and spiritual maturity.
